Back in 1987, Hasbro partnered with Nikko to manufacture one item I had wanted since the VAMP was released in 1982: a remote controlled vehicle! Sure the MOBAT was fun, but you couldn't steer it from afar. Enter: the Crossfire! Hasbro made two versions of the Crossfire (Alpha 27 and Delta 49) that utilize unique radio frequencies so they can race each other. Unfortunately, a rival Cobra R/C car was never introduced.
